Ubuntu 12.10ラップトップを使用してSony Xperia Uでファイルを検索できない


8

以前はUbuntu 12.04を使用していました。携帯電話(Sony Xperia U)をMTPモードで接続すると、Nautilusでそれを「SEMC HSUSBデバイス」として表示し、ファイルを参照したり、ファイルをコピーしたりできます。

今、私は新しいラップトップを持っていて、それにUbuntu 12.10をインストールしました。私のデバイスがNautilusによって認識されなくなった-/ var / log / syslogに表示されるエントリを見るとOSがそれを認識していることがわかります-しかし、電話がマウントされず、アクセスする方法を考えることができません電話にファイルを保存し、非常に遅いBluetoothを除いて新しいファイルをそこに置きます。

他に誰かがそのような問題に直面しましたか?手伝ってくれますか?


2
XDAでこのスレッドを見ましたか?
シド

私の最初の考えは「いくつかのudevルールが欠けている」ことでした、そしてそのXDAの投稿はこれについて正確に言及しています。@シド-それを回答に入れて、XDA投稿からの短い要約を添えてくれませんか?それがまさにこの質問への答えです。
イジー

@Izzy Done。してください見てい D:
シド

@シド・ユップ、素晴らしい-私からの+1:D
イジー

こんにちは、私はあなたの答えにコメントしました。
airbornemihir

回答:


4

Samsung Galaxy Tab2 7.0タブレットとGalaxy S3 Miniスマートフォンの両方で最も簡単な方法は、SSHDroid(Androidデバイス上)を使用してSSHサーバーを提供することです。

Google Play> BerserkerによるSSHDroid

次に、WiFi経由でSSHを使用してNautilusから接続します。これはかなり高速で、リンクをブックマークして再利用できます(IPアドレスが静的なままの場合)。初めて使用した後は、これらのMACアドレスに対してルーターの静的IPを設定するだけです。

また、デバイスへのSSHコマンドラインセッションにターミナルを使用しました。これもSSHDroidサービスを使用するだけです。



3

別の接続モードを選択できますmass storage mode。これにより、USBケーブルを接続したときに自動的に検出されます。接続モードを変更するオプションは次のとおりです。

Setting -> Xperia -> Connectivity -> USB Connection mode

アンドロイド5.1.1のXperia Z3にそれが今です:Settings > Xperia Connectivity > USB connectivity。また、SSDカードでのみ機能し、内部ストレージでは機能しません。
Ciro Santilli冠状病毒审查六四事件法轮功

2

Xperia UをICS Linuxにアップグレードした後、SEMC HSUSBデバイスがリストされているため、Mint Mayaがデバイスを認識しなくなりました。何らかの理由でMTPサポートが変更され、ドラッグアンドドロップするオプションがなくなりました。

代わりに、通常のリポジトリの「qlix」または「gmtp」を使用してください。私の好みはqlixです。

  • 電話を接続してqlixを起動し、数分間そのままにします。最終的には、Xperia Uを認識します。
  • 左側のペインはデスクトップファイルシステム、右側のペインはAndroidファイルシステムです。

その場合は、両側で正しいフォルダを開き、転送するファイルを右クリックするだけです。

デバイスの初期マウントは遅いですが、その後のファイルの転送は高速で、MTPを使用しているため、ファイルシステムの残りの部分は破損しないように安全です。

デバイスをアンマウントする必要がなくなりました。


メイトに感謝しますが、qlixをインストールしようとしましたが、それも電話を検出できませんでした。また、gmtpもありません(両方とも、デバイスを検出できなかったというエラーを返します)。充電するために(qlixまたはgmtpを使用せずに)、SEMC HSUSBデバイスを検出できなかったことを示すポップアップメッセージが表示されます。要するに-まだ立ち往生しています。
airbornemihir

私はエキスパートではありませんが、私のマシンでは、あなたと同じエラーメッセージが表示されます。MTPのサポートはAndroidとLinuxの間で非常に大雑把です。両方がLinuxシステムであることを考えると、奇妙で​​す。
ケビンラムゼイ2013

@airbornemihir qlixを使用する場合は、接続するまで待機して待つ必要があります。それが機能しない場合は、gmtpを使用して接続するまでさらに長く待機する必要があります。デバイスがないというエラーメッセージが表示されます。[接続]をクリックして、5分間そのままにしておきます。他のGUIボタンをクリックしないでください。クリックすると、常にクラッシュします。mtpのサポートはひどいandroidですが、ラッキーかもしれません-Linux mint live cdを使ってみて、それで動作するかどうかを確認してください。私は「mate」DEを使用しています
Kevin Ramsay

ありがとう、ケビン!私にとって、qlixは死ぬ前にしばらくかき回しました。しかし、gmtpは高速でシンプルで成功しました。Kubuntu-12.10とXperia Rayを使用します。
Skippy VonDrake 2013年

1

以下の手順に従ってください。

  1. スマートフォンをラップトップに接続し、lsusbコマンドを使用して端末にデバイスをリストします

  2. 以下のような行を検索Bus 002 Device 012: ID 0fce:5169 Sony Ericsson Mobile Communications ABし、あるベンダーと製品IDに注意0fceし、5169上記の行で、それぞれを。USBデバッグを無効にしている場合、製品IDはになります0169。次に電話を取り外します。

  3. humans-enabled.comに移動し、libmtpの最新バージョンをインストール69-libmtp.rules/etc/udev/rules.d、説明に従ってファイルをにコピーします

  4. オプションのステップ

    Xperia Sサポートがlibmtp-1.1.3リリースに実装されています。sourceforge.netの最新バージョンを使用している場合は、手順5に進みます。ルートとしてコピーしたファイルを

    入力sudo gedit /etc/udev/rules.d/69-libmtp.rulesして編集します。

    このファイル内のソニーエリクソンデバイスの周りのどこかに次のテキストを追加します。0fceを検索すると、それらを見つけることができます。正しいベンダーと製品IDを忘れずに設定してください

    ATTR{idVendor}=="0fce", ATTR{idProduct}=="5169", SYMLINK+="libmtp-%k", ENV{ID_MTP_DEVICE}="1", ENV{ID_MEDIA_PLAYER}="1" ATTR{idVendor}=="0fce", ATTR{idProduct}=="0169", SYMLINK+="libmtp-%k", ENV{ID_MTP_DEVICE}="1", ENV{ID_MEDIA_PLAYER}="1"

  5. 再起動するかsudo udevadm control --reload-rules、アクチュアライズに使用します。

  6. スマートフォンを差し込むと、自動的にマウントされます。nautilusを使用してファイルをコピーする

詳細はこちらをご覧ください


これはUbuntuの(特にudev構文)ですか? 11.xの)ですか、それとも最新(12.10)ですか?
david6 2012

1
ありがとう。私は1行の変更で、あなたが推奨される手順に従っ:私はUbuntuのダウンロードウズウズしパッケージしlibmtp、sourceforgeの最新バージョンに対応するバージョン1.1.5を取得しました。私の場合の製品IDは、提案したものではなく5171と0171でした。これらを/etc/rules.d/70-libmtp.rules file(これはオーバーライドすることになっている空のファイルです/lib/udev/rules.d/69-libmtp.rules)にコピーして実行しましたsudo udevadm control --reload-rules。まだ成功していません。
airbornemihir
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.